Learning Frameworks Antisemitism training offer

The new antisemitism awareness training is now available to book as part of our Off-the-Shelf (OTS) learning offer. This training provides teams with the knowledge and tools to identify, understand, and challenge antisemitic behaviour.

There are two training products which are available to book as closed courses.
• 1-Hour Awareness Webinar: Designed for large groups, this session can accommodate up to 500 attendees. It serves as a high-impact, introductory session suitable for broad departmental dissemination.
• 90-Minute Team Session: Tailored for smaller groups (with a recommended maximum of 50 attendees), this format offers a more interactive and focused experience. It is ideal for fostering deeper team discussions and practical understanding.
